| Sampling Factors: |
Location (Not Relevant: All same location.)
Customer (Not Relevant: All same types of customers.)
Size (Not Relevant: All work is highly complex and therefore size doesn”t change the engineering.)
Organizational Structure (Not Relevant: All same organization.)
Type of Work: Different types of technologies require different engineering disciplines and management structures. |
| Sampling Factor Values: |
MAALOT (Type of Work): Signal Intelligence, Early Warning, and Communications
MAROM (Type of Work): Airborne Early Warning
MISGAV (Type of Work): Radars and ImInt |
